The ethyl cellulose manganese(ii) hydrogen phosphate was synthesised by sol-gelmethod using various 1:1 electrolytes at different temperature and concentration. thesematerials were characterized by using fourier transform infrared (ftir) spectroscopy,ultraviolet-visible (uv-vis) spectroscopy and ph meter. this material refers a new class ofmaterial as it contains both organic that is a polymer and inorganic parts along with theimproved chemical as well as mechanical stabilities. the material conductivity generallydecreases in the order k+ > na+ for 1:1 electrolyte solution. this study displayed theapplications of conductivity of materials in the varied field of science. the material exhibitedinhibitory results against gram positive bacteria like staphylococcus aureus (mssa-22) andgram negative bacteria like escherichia coli (k-12), and it marked the enhancement in theeffectiveness of the antibacterial agent
